DFW AIRPORT A $37 BILLION ECONOMIC FORCE A 2015 study conducted by the Perryman Group reported DFW Airport delivers over $37 billion dollars in economic impact for the North Texas region, and supports 228,000 jobs in the area with an associated payroll of $12.5 billion each year. DFW Airport knows the value of diversity in the business world which has yielded significant economicresults.

2014 Kansas City Southern Founded in 1887, KCS is 126 years old More than 6,100 miles of track US -Mexico cross border railroad Serves 12 Ports in the Gulf and one in the Pacific Serves more than 140 transload terminals and 11 intermodal ramps 181 interchange points with all Class I railroads in the US and Mexico Kansas City SouthernRailway

MEXICO IN A WORLD OF TECHNOLOGY In 2019, software sales in Mexico reached over $5 billion, while revenue in the e-commerce market amounted to $9 billion. IT services are also fueling the rapidly accelerating tech industry in Mexico and the sector broke sales of $6.2 billion in the same year.
